Plot Overview: What is Prisoners About?
Keller Dover is facing every parent’s worst nightmare. His six-year-old daughter, Anna, is missing, together with her young friend, Joy, and as minutes turn to hours, panic sets in. The only lead is a dilapidated RV that had earlier been parked on their street.

The performances within Prisoners are nothing short of phenomenal, elevating an already intense script to extraordinary heights. Hugh Jackman delivers a career-defining turn as Keller Dover, embodying a father's raw, animalistic desperation with terrifying conviction and heartbreaking vulnerability. His portrayal of a man teetering on the edge of sanity is utterly captivating. Complementing this ferocity is Jake Gyllenhaal as Detective Loki, whose nuanced performance presents a dedicated, observant detective haunted by the case, offering a compelling contrast to Dover's impulsiveness. And the formidable Viola Davis, as Nancy Birch, provides a powerful and grounded presence, representing the quiet anguish and moral compass amidst the chaos. Denis Villeneuve's direction is impeccable, orchestrating a slow-burn pace that builds unbearable tension, while the stunning cinematography creates a bleak, oppressive atmosphere perfectly mirroring the characters' grim reality.
